Understanding Google Apps Script
Before diving into the world of macros, it’s crucial to understand the underlying engine that powers them: Google Apps Script. This powerful scripting language allows you to extend the functionality of Google Workspace applications, including Google Sheets, Docs, Slides, and Gmail. Think of Apps Script as the language that speaks to your spreadsheets, enabling you to automate actions and create custom functions.
Key Features of Google Apps Script
- Event-driven programming: Apps Script primarily operates in response to events, such as a spreadsheet being opened, a cell being edited, or a button being clicked.
- Object-oriented: It follows object-oriented principles, allowing you to organize your code into reusable components and classes.
- Integration with Google Services: Apps Script seamlessly integrates with other Google services like Drive, Gmail, Calendar, and Forms, enabling you to build powerful applications that leverage these services.
- Cloud-based Execution: Your Apps Script code runs in Google’s secure cloud environment, eliminating the need for local installations or server management.
Creating Your First Macro
Now that you have a grasp of Apps Script, let’s get our hands dirty and create a simple macro. For this example, we’ll create a macro that formats a selected range of cells as bold and changes their background color to yellow.
Steps to Create a Macro
1.
Open your Google Sheet and navigate to the “Tools” menu. Select “Script editor” to launch the Apps Script environment.
2.
In the script editor, you’ll see a basic template code. Delete the existing code and paste the following:
“`javascript
function formatCells() {
var sheet = SpreadsheetApp.getActiveSheet();
var range = sheet.getActiveRange();
range.setFontWeight(“bold”);
range.setBackground(“yellow”);
}
“`
3.

4.
Back in your spreadsheet, select the range of cells you want to format.
5.
Go to the “Tools” menu and select “Macros.” In the “Macros” dialog box, find your newly created macro (“FormatCellsMacro”) and click “Run.”
Your selected cells will now be formatted as bold with a yellow background. Congratulations! You’ve successfully created and run your first macro in Google Sheets.
Running Macros with Triggers
While manually running macros is convenient for one-off tasks, triggers take automation to the next level. Triggers allow you to schedule your macros to run automatically at specific times or in response to certain events. This is particularly useful for repetitive tasks that need to be performed regularly.
Setting Up Triggers
1.
In the Apps Script editor, click on the “Triggers” icon in the left sidebar.
2.
Click on the “+ Add Trigger” button to create a new trigger.

Choose the function you want to trigger (in our case, “formatCells”).
4.
Select the event that should trigger the function. Common options include “From spreadsheet,” “On edit,” or “Time-driven.”
5.
Configure the trigger settings, such as the time of day, specific sheet, or event type.
6.
Save the trigger. Now, your macro will run automatically whenever the specified event occurs.
Exploring Advanced Macro Functionality
The world of Google Sheets macros extends far beyond simple formatting tasks. You can leverage Apps Script to perform a wide range of complex operations, including:
Data Manipulation
- Importing and exporting data: Fetch data from external sources like CSV files or APIs and import it into your spreadsheet.
- Data cleaning and transformation: Clean up messy data, remove duplicates, and transform data into desired formats.
- Data analysis and calculations: Perform complex calculations, create pivot tables, and generate insightful reports.
User Interface Enhancements
- Creating custom menus and buttons: Add interactive elements to your spreadsheet to streamline workflows and make your sheets more user-friendly.
- Building custom dialog boxes: Create interactive forms to collect user input and automate data entry.
- Adding validation rules: Enforce data integrity by setting rules that ensure data entered into specific cells meets certain criteria.
Integration with Other Services
- Sending emails: Automate email notifications based on spreadsheet events or data changes.
- Updating Google Calendar events: Sync data from your spreadsheet with your Google Calendar to manage appointments and events.
- Posting to social media: Share spreadsheet data or insights on social media platforms.
